Lyndon J. Roberts, 85 died at his home on November 3, 2025 after an extended illness.
A memorial service will be held at the Fern Township Cemetery in Becida, MN on Sunday June 14, 2026 at 11:00 AM. A celebration of Lyndon's life will follow at the Becida Bar and Grill.
Lyndon was born on May 20, 1940 to Earl and Margaret (Sankey) Roberts of Becida, Mn. Lyndon attended the Sankey School. In 1959 he enlisted in the US Army.
Lyndon served his country with great pride and honor. He was awarded the Bronze Star while serving one of his two tours in Vietnam. Lyndon retired from the Army as a Master Sergeant. Lyndon was very musically inclined and could play several instruments, he especially excelled at and enjoyed playing the guitar. Lyndon also enjoyed playing cards, dancing, fishing, hunting and gardening.
Along with his parents, Lyndon was preceded in death by his brothers George, Lyle, Stanley, Leslie, Dale, and Earl Robers and his sisters Jessie Benson, Margaret Rearick, and Janet Malterud. He is survived by his wife Amy and numerous nieces and nephews and grand nieces and nephews.
